South Beach being now managed by JW Marriott, it calls for a Spa to be included to meet the operation requirements of the hotel. For this purpose an entire level of guestrooms on the 2nd Level was converted into the spa.

In line with Marriott’s new concept, the Spa at JW Marriott South Beach, Singapore is a temple for restoration of one’s mind and body in an urban hospitality establishment, where the benefits of the spa on one’s health and well-being should be no mystery.

The whole project takes on a stance to demystify the spa experience by taking the guest on a journey that is simple and approachable.

Changing Area & Lounge
Natural materials and a light refreshing palette, comprising of oiled matt cross-cut timber mosaic, against a seamless poured terrazzo floor guides guests into the spa reception, juxtaposed against armourcoat plaster and grey timber veneer walls.
Whilst privacy is highly valued and sacred in any spa design, the design of JW Marriott South Bridges’ challenged the norm to ensure there was a certain lightness and fluidity to the spaces without compromising the guest experience. It was simple and approachable, where focus was done to ensure to make it effortlessly comfortable, private and not intimidating.
The rooms are sophisticated and warm without being pretentious and fussy favored by other spas. The interiors are designed to sustain and restore the guest’s personal equilibrium. For an uncluttered space, all the equipment and storage were planned to be integrated into the joinery.
